The Concept and Game Setting
EuropeTransit immerses players in the vibrant landscape of Europe, challenging them to manage a vast network of train services stretching across the continent. The game is set in a beautifully rendered map of Europe, where players must strategize to build and manage operational transit systems that connect cities, manage resources, and respond to real-time events that impact the gameplay dynamic.
The setting uncovers a historically rich tapestry, bringing players through architectural wonders, stunning landscapes, and bustling cityscapes. Each location within Europe is meticulously crafted to offer an authentic feel, enhanced by real-world inspired quests and scenarios that challenge players to think critically about transit management and urban planning.
Getting Started with EuropeTransit
Upon starting the game, players are introduced to their role as the head of a transcontinental rail company. The primary objective is to establish an efficient and profitable railway network across Europe. Players begin with a modest budget and limited resources — a handful of train types, a starting city, and a basic understanding of local economics.
The game's tutorial mode is designed to ease players into complex systems, and provides guidance while keeping options open for strategic experimentation. Players are encouraged to explore different geographical and economic strengths of cities to bolster their network.
Game Objectives and Dynamic Challenges
The overarching goal in EuropeTransit is to expand the railway empire while maintaining customer satisfaction and adhering to economic constraints. The game introduces various objectives such as:
- Network Expansion: Develop routes covering major towns and cities to capture market demand.
- Fiscal Management: Ensure profitability through ticket pricing strategies, maintenance costs, and smart investment in technology upgrades.
- Environmental Management: Address climate challenges by optimizing routes and investing in sustainable technologies.
EuropeTransit simulates real-time challenges that influence the railways. Players will face hurdles like weather disruptions, city demand shifts, technical failures, and economic crises that demand quick decision-making and long-term planning.
Innovative Gameplay Features
The developers at HawkGaming have infused EuropeTransit with a range of features to enhance gameplay complexity and realism.
Real-Time Economy and Weather Systems
The game's dynamic economy reacts to players' decisions and external factors, such as geopolitical events and market trends. Weather systems add layers of unpredictability, affecting train speeds, passenger numbers, and causing potential delays. This demands strategic foresight and adaptable planning from players.
Passenger Simulation
EuropeTransit levels up the challenge with a detailed passenger simulation system. Each virtual traveler has unique needs, preferences, and travel patterns. Catering to these demands creates a nuanced layer of customer interaction, where satisfying passengers can significantly boost the player’s railway reputation and profits.
Skill Development and Research Tree
Players can invest in research and development to unlock advanced technology, from faster train models to AI-driven transit solutions. The skill development tree allows for specialization in areas such as rapid transit, luxury services, or cargo efficiency, making strategic depth a significant component of the game.
Integrating Current Events
A standout feature of EuropeTransit is its incorporation of current events into the gameplay. HawkGaming updates scenarios to reflect global events, from climate policies to economic shifts in Europe, ensuring that players face realistic and continuously evolving challenges.
Recent updates have included scenarios reflecting energy crises impacting cargo transport, prompting players to explore energy-efficient solutions. Additionally, events like international summits influence passenger numbers and route popularity, mirroring real-world implications.
